import os
|
|
import sys
|
|
import shutil
|
|
import errno
|
|
import time
|
|
import hashlib
|
|
from selenium import webdriver
|
|
from selenium.webdriver.common.by import By
|
|
from selenium.webdriver.support.ui import WebDriverWait
|
|
from selenium.webdriver.support import expected_conditions
|
|
|
|
if "TRAVIS_BUILD_NUMBER" in os.environ:
|
|
if not "SAUCE_USERNAME" in os.environ:
|
|
print "No sauce labs login credentials found. Stopping tests..."
|
|
sys.exit(0)
|
|
|
|
capabilities = {'browserName': "firefox"}
|
|
capabilities['platform'] = "Windows 7"
|
|
capabilities['version'] = "48.0"
|
|
capabilities['screenResolution'] = "1280x1024"
|
|
capabilities["build"] = os.environ["TRAVIS_BUILD_NUMBER"]
|
|
capabilities["tunnel-identifier"] = os.environ["TRAVIS_JOB_NUMBER"]
|
|
|
|
# connect to sauce labs
|
|
username = os.environ["SAUCE_USERNAME"]
|
|
access_key = os.environ["SAUCE_ACCESS_KEY"]
|
|
hub_url = "%s:%s@localhost:4445" % (username, access_key)
|
|
driver = webdriver.Remote(command_executor="http://%s/wd/hub" % hub_url, desired_capabilities=capabilities)
|
|
else:
|
|
# local
|
|
print "Using LOCAL webdriver"
|
|
driver = webdriver.Firefox()
|
|
driver.maximize_window()
|
|
|
|
|
|
def write_random_file(size, filename):
|
|
if not os.path.exists(os.path.dirname(filename)):
|
|
try:
|
|
os.makedirs(os.path.dirname(filename))
|
|
except OSError as exc: # Guard against race condition
|
|
if exc.errno != errno.EEXIST:
|
|
raise
|
|
|
|
with open(filename, 'wb') as fout:
|
|
fout.write(os.urandom(size))
|
|
|
|
|
|
def sha1_file(filename):
|
|
BLOCKSIZE = 65536
|
|
hasher = hashlib.sha1()
|
|
with open(filename, 'rb') as afile:
|
|
buf = afile.read(BLOCKSIZE)
|
|
while len(buf) > 0:
|
|
hasher.update(buf)
|
|
buf = afile.read(BLOCKSIZE)
|
|
|
|
return hasher.hexdigest()
|
|
|
|
|
|
def sha1_folder(folder):
|
|
sha1_dict = {}
|
|
for root, dirs, files in os.walk(folder):
|
|
for filename in files:
|
|
file_path = os.path.join(root, filename)
|
|
sha1 = sha1_file(file_path)
|
|
relative_file_path = os.path.relpath(file_path, folder)
|
|
sha1_dict.update({relative_file_path: sha1})
|
|
|
|
return sha1_dict
|
|
|
|
|
|
def wait_for_text(time, xpath, text):
|
|
WebDriverWait(driver, time).until(expected_conditions.text_to_be_present_in_element((By.XPATH, xpath), text))
|
|
|
|
|
|
BACKUP_NAME = "BackupName"
|
|
PASSWORD = "the_backup_password_is_really_long_and_safe"
|
|
SOURCE_FOLDER = "duplicati_gui_test_source"
|
|
DESTINATION_FOLDER = "duplicati_gui_test_destination"
|
|
DESTINATION_FOLDER_DIRECT_RESTORE = "duplicati_gui_test_destination_direct_restore"
|
|
RESTORE_FOLDER = "duplicati_gui_test_restore"
|
|
DIRECT_RESTORE_FOLDER = "duplicati_gui_test_direct_restore"
|
|
|
|
# wait 5 seconds for duplicati server to start
|
|
time.sleep(5)
|
|
|
|
driver.implicitly_wait(10)
|
|
driver.get("http://localhost:8200/ngax/index.html")
|
|
|
|
if not "Duplicati" in driver.title:
|
|
raise Exception("Unable to load duplicati GUI!")
|
|
|
|
# Create and hash random files in the source folder
|
|
write_random_file(1024 * 1024, SOURCE_FOLDER + os.sep + "1MB.test")
|
|
write_random_file(100 * 1024, SOURCE_FOLDER + os.sep + "subfolder" + os.sep + "100KB.test")
|
|
sha1_source = sha1_folder(SOURCE_FOLDER)
|
|
|
|
# Add new backup
|
|
driver.find_element_by_link_text("Add new backup").click()
|
|
|
|
# Add new backup - General page
|
|
time.sleep(1)
|
|
driver.find_element_by_id("name").send_keys(BACKUP_NAME)
|
|
driver.find_element_by_id("target").send_keys("file://" + DESTINATION_FOLDER)
|
|
driver.find_element_by_id("passphrase").send_keys(PASSWORD)
|
|
driver.find_element_by_id("repeat-passphrase").send_keys(PASSWORD)
|
|
driver.find_element_by_id("nextStep1").click()
|
|
|
|
# Add new backup - Source Data page
|
|
driver.find_element_by_id("sourcePath").send_keys(os.path.abspath(SOURCE_FOLDER) + os.sep)
|
|
driver.find_element_by_id("sourceFolderPathAdd").click()
|
|
driver.find_element_by_id("nextStep2").click()
|
|
|
|
# Add new backup - Schedule page
|
|
useScheduleRun = driver.find_element_by_id("useScheduleRun")
|
|
if useScheduleRun.is_selected():
|
|
useScheduleRun.click()
|
|
driver.find_element_by_id("nextStep3").click()
|
|
|
|
# Add new backup - Options page
|
|
driver.find_element_by_id("save").click()
|
|
|
|
# Run the backup job and wait for finish
|
|
driver.find_element_by_link_text("Run now").click()
|
|
wait_for_text(60, "//div[@class='task ng-scope']/dl[2]/dd[1]", "(took ")
|
|
|
|
# Restore
|
|
driver.find_element_by_link_text(BACKUP_NAME).click()
|
|
driver.find_element_by_xpath("//span[contains(text(),'Restore files ...')]").click()
|
|
driver.find_element_by_xpath("//span[contains(text(),'" + SOURCE_FOLDER + "')]") # wait for filelist
|
|
time.sleep(1)
|
|
driver.find_element_by_xpath("//restore-file-picker/ul/li/div/a[2]").click() # select root folder checkbox
|
|
driver.find_element_by_link_text("Continue").click()
|
|
driver.find_element_by_id("restoretonewpath").click()
|
|
driver.find_element_by_id("restore_path").send_keys(RESTORE_FOLDER)
|
|
driver.find_element_by_link_text("Restore").click()
|
|
# wait for restore to finish
|
|
wait_for_text(60, "//form[@id='restore']/div[3]/h3/div[1]", "Your files and folders have been restored successfully.")
|
|
|
|
# hash restored files
|
|
sha1_restore = sha1_folder(RESTORE_FOLDER)
|
|
|
|
# cleanup: delete source and restore folder and rename destination folder for direct restore
|
|
shutil.rmtree(SOURCE_FOLDER)
|
|
shutil.rmtree(RESTORE_FOLDER)
|
|
os.rename(DESTINATION_FOLDER, DESTINATION_FOLDER_DIRECT_RESTORE)
|
|
|
|
# direct restore
|
|
driver.find_element_by_link_text("Restore backup").click()
|
|
driver.find_element_by_id("target").send_keys("file://" + DESTINATION_FOLDER_DIRECT_RESTORE)
|
|
driver.find_element_by_id("password").send_keys(PASSWORD)
|
|
driver.find_element_by_link_text("Connect").click()
|
|
driver.find_element_by_xpath("//span[contains(text(),'" + SOURCE_FOLDER + "')]") # wait for filelist
|
|
time.sleep(1)
|
|
driver.find_element_by_xpath("//restore-file-picker/ul/li/div/a[2]").click() # select root folder checkbox
|
|
driver.find_element_by_link_text("Continue").click()
|
|
driver.find_element_by_id("restoretonewpath").click()
|
|
driver.find_element_by_id("restore_path").send_keys(DIRECT_RESTORE_FOLDER)
|
|
driver.find_element_by_link_text("Restore").click()
|
|
# wait for restore to finish
|
|
wait_for_text(60, "//form[@id='restore']/div[3]/h3/div[1]", "Your files and folders have been restored successfully.")
|
|
|
|
# hash direct restore files
|
|
sha1_direct_restore = sha1_folder(DIRECT_RESTORE_FOLDER)
|
|
|
|
print "Source hashes: " + str(sha1_source)
|
|
print "Restore hashes: " + str(sha1_restore)
|
|
print "Direct Restore hashes: " + str(sha1_direct_restore)
|
|
|
|
# Tell Sauce Labs to stop the test
|
|
driver.quit()
|
|
|
|
if not (sha1_source == sha1_restore and sha1_source == sha1_direct_restore):
|
|
sys.exit(1) # return with error
